Forecast: Whole Fresh Sandy Ray Production in Capture Fisheries for Human Consumption in France

In 2024, the whole fresh Sandy Ray production in capture fisheries for human consumption in France is forecasted at 36.7 metric tons, indicating a steady increase compared to 2023 figures. Year-on-year growth from 2024 through 2028 shows a consistent upward trajectory, with annual increases ranging from 2.91% in 2025 to 1.47% in 2028. Over the five-year period, a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of approximately 2.17% reflects sustained growth in production volumes.
